When ice melts and becomes a liquid it is a physical change. When the liquid boils and becomes gaseous it is a physical change. It is a chemical change when the molecular structure has been changed in some way, here it has not.

Yes, the mass of the melted ice cube remains the same as the original ice cube. When ice melts, it undergoes a phase change from a solid to a liquid, but the total amount of matter remains constant.

When a cube of ice melts to form water, it undergoes a physical change. This is because the substance remains water in both states, but changes from a solid form (ice) to a liquid form (water) due to a change in temperature.

A physical change in an ice cube can be suggested by observing a change in its shape, size, or phase. For example, if an ice cube melts into water or is crushed into smaller pieces, it indicates a physical change has occurred.
